About the Role
We're looking for a Midweight Graphic Designer — a versatile creative professional who can bring ideas to life across digital, print, motion, and UX. This is a hands-on role for someone who thrives on crafting engaging visual experiences that tell a story, elevate brand identity, and deliver impact.
You'll work closely with a collaborative, multidisciplinary team to deliver innovative design solutions — from concept to execution — across a wide range of creative projects.
Key Responsibilities
- Digital & Print Design: Design striking layouts, infographics, and branded materials for proposals, presentations, brochures, and marketing assets — both static and animated.
- Motion Design: Create dynamic motion graphics, animations, and interactive content using Adobe Creative Suite and other motion tools.
- UX/UI Design: Develop intuitive, user-friendly digital experiences, collaborating with developers to ensure functionality, accessibility, and cohesion.
- Print Production: Deliver artwork for small- and large-format print, including signage, hoardings, and wayfinding graphics, ensuring top-quality output through vendor coordination.
Skills & Experience
- 2+ years' professional experience in graphic, motion, and/or UX/UI design (degree preferred but not essential).
- Advanced pro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ign, After Effects, Premiere Pro) and UX tools (Figma, Sketch, etc.).
- A strong portfolio showcasing creativity, innovation, and technical skill across branding, motion, and digital design.
- Proven ability to manage multiple projects and meet tight deadlines with exceptional attention to detail.
- Excellent communication and collaboration skills — able to present ideas clearly and work effectively across teams.
- Experience in mentoring or leading creative direction is a plus.
